Medical History of World War I
23-25 February 2012

The Department of Medical History of the Uniformed Services University of the Health Sciences and the U.S. Army Medical Department Center of History and Heritage will co-sponsor an international conference on the medical history of World War I, including a variety of topics, including diseases, humanitarian medical work in the midst of war, medical professionalism, public health and the influenza pandemic, and other topics.

The conference will be held at the Army Medical Department Museum on historic Fort Sam Houston, in San Antonio, Texas.  Meeting support is being generously provided by the Army Medical Department Museum Foundation. 

Registration, including whole-conference and one-day registrations, will be open shortly.  Space will be limited, so please register early. Information will be posted at http://history.amedd.army.mil/ as it comes available.
